Appiate victims need urgent support to bring lives back on track – Mahama to Nana Addo

John Mahama and President Akufo-Addo

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Former President John Dramani Mahama has urged the ruling government to act proactively to ensure that the people of Appiate are supported to bring their lives back on track.

According to Mr. Mahama, even though the government has rolled out programmes in support of the victims, the need to intensify its support system is key.

Former President John Mahama presenting relief items to the Appiati victims

At least 13 people were killed in an explosion near a mining town in the Western Region. This happened after a truck carrying explosives to a gold mining site crashed with a motorcycle near the town of Bogoso.

The former President made the call when he visited the Appiate community on Tuesday, August 16, 2022, to interact with the chiefs, the Appiate Disaster Relief Committee, and the people of the community.

In a Facebook post he wrote “In my remarks, I reiterated the concern of the affected community about compensation and urged the government to act proactively to ensure that the people are supported to bring their lives back on track.

“The people have appreciated the response and support from the government after the disaster but their continued livelihoods are also important,” Mr. Mahama said.

As part of the visitation in response to complaints about the reduction in voluntary relief support to the people, John Dramani Mahama presented a quantity of food and non-food items to the Member of Parliament for Prestea Huni Valley, the Municipal Chief Executive, and the Appiate Disaster Relief Committee to be made available to the people.
The donated Food items by Former President John Mahama

He also presented them with an amount of money to support the further treatment of some of the injured victims.
